    In North America, they call leftists liberals & don’t split hairs like Europe & Latin America.

    In Europe and Latin America, liberalism means a moderate form of classical liberalism and includes both conservative liberalism (centre-right liberalism) and social liberalism (centre-left liberalism). In North America, liberalism almost exclusively refers to social liberalism.

    People in the US get seriously confused that the Liberal party in other countries (eg, Australia) isn’t liberal.
